BTC Technical Analysis: Setting Up for Consolidation Breakout

Bitcoin’s current technical structure presents a textbook consolidation pattern with bullish undertones. The RSI reading of 47.59 indicates neutral momentum with room for upward movement, while the MACD histogram showing 1127.4492 suggests underlying bullish pressure building beneath the surface.

The Bollinger Bands position at 0.7248 places Bitcoin in the upper portion of its recent trading range, indicating strength without extreme overbought conditions. This positioning typically precedes either a breakout above the upper band at $95,595 or a pullback toward the middle band support at $89,972.

Volume analysis from Binance spot markets shows $1.63 billion in 24-hour activity, sufficient to support meaningful price movements but lacking the explosive character typically associated with major breakouts. The Average True Range of $3,623 suggests moderate volatility conditions conducive to measured technical moves rather than dramatic price swings.

Critical pattern recognition reveals Bitcoin trading above its 7-day SMA ($90,962) and 20-day SMA ($89,972) while remaining below the 50-day ($99,905) and 200-day ($109,370) moving averages. This configuration suggests short-term strength within a broader corrective phase from November highs.

Understanding the Mechanics of a Fed Rate Cut When the Federal Reserve implements a Fed rate cut, it’s not just a number on a screen; it has far-reaching implications. The federal funds rate is the interest rate at which commercial banks borrow and lend their excess reserves to each other overnight. By lowering this benchmark, the Fed aims to make borrowing cheaper across the entire economy. Stimulating Economic Activity: Lower interest rates can encourage businesses to borrow and invest more, potentially leading to job creation and economic growth. Impact on Consumers: Mortgages, car loans, and credit card interest rates often follow the federal funds rate, meaning consumers could see lower borrowing costs. Inflationary Pressures: While stimulating, excessive rate cuts can sometimes lead to inflation if the economy overheats. The Fed’s balancing act is always crucial.
